Product liability cases involve a liable party and an injured party. The responsible party in such cases is usually the producer of the defective product that injured or harmed a consumer. This type of product liability cases also involves property damage caused by the faulty product. The manufacturer does not have to be negligent to be forced to take responsibility for the losses and/or injuries the consumer has suffered.A There is a perfectly adequate defective product law in Maryland and with the help of a personal injury lawyer in Annapolis, you can make the responsible party for your loss or injury.Defective Product law in MarylandThe product may be faulty because of numerous reasons. Maybe the product failed because of its design or manufacturing, marketing, production or transport. While you are not at fault, you can make the producer liable and start a defective product lawsuit in MD or reach a settlement.The product itself can be anything from food, tools, and machines to instruments and devices. For example, if a skateboarder crashes because of a defect in the skateboard structure (either from manufacturing flaw or design), they are entitled to fair compensation by the producer. It is also valid if someone was electrocuted by a faulty household appliance that was not wired correctly or cut by a poorly made saw blade. The injured or hurt person is entitled to fair compensation. A The product liability law in MD also covers product recalls, where a product is released while it is still in a state that can injure the consumer. Any injury or harm done to the consumer, if proved to be because of a manufacturing error, will lead to compensation.Proving you are not responsible for the defectThe main problem is that you have to demonstrate that the manufacturing defects were not caused by you. To show the product is faulty in a defective product lawsuit in MD, the plaintiff needs to prove that the product was defective at the time of manufacture.
